About this prompt
This prompt helps an AE, CSM, or AM resolve friction with their counterpart on a shared account when the two are stepping on each other or disagree on how to handle the customer. It names the real disagreement, applies an account-first tiebreaker, and gives you the opener for a constructive conversation. Use it when the friction is actively slowing a deal, renewal, or relationship.When an AE and CSM clash over who owns the expansion or how to handle a customer, the dispute usually costs the account before either person wins it. This prompt helps you resolve it constructively. Describe the account in CUSTOMER, VALUE, WHAT'S HAPPENING; name the conflict in WHAT WE DISAGREE ON; lay out BOTH SIDES; state what's at risk in THE DEAL/RENEWAL/RELATIONSHIP THIS IS AFFECTING; and rate the working relationship in GOOD / STRAINED. It pins whether the friction is about ownership, priorities, approach, or coordination, reframes it around what's best for the account, steelmans the other person's position, gives you a fair resolution and a collaborative opener, and proposes a working agreement to prevent a repeat. Use this for an active two-person dispute, not for setting up co-ownership from scratch — the joint account-plan prompt covers that. Tip: fill BOTH SIDES honestly, because the prompt will tell you when you're the one over-reaching, and that read is the most useful part.The prompt
